CEO of Scouts NSW steps down

Published Tue 20 Jan 2026

After four years in the role, Carolyn Campbell will step down from her role as CEO of Scouts NSW. 

Carolyn has been instrumental in implementing changes necessary to strengthen the organisation’s long-term resilience, with particular emphasis on financial sustainability, governance, risk and compliance.

Her leadership, decisiveness and professionalism have contributed to progress that is being made across the organisation, and she will be greatly missed.

Carolyn said, “Leading Scouts NSW has been one of the most meaningful chapters of my career. The resilience and spirit of our Staff, volunteers, and youth members have shaped me in ways I will always carry forward. I want to express my sincere thanks to the Board for their trust, guidance, and unwavering commitment to young people across the state. As I move into the role of CEO at Hockey NSW, I do so with immense pride in what we’ve achieved together and with deep appreciation for the Scouting community. The values of leadership, service, and belonging that define Scouts NSW will continue to guide me as I take on this new challenge.”

Carolyn will remain with Scouts NSW for three months to work closely with The Board to ensure a smooth transition, before taking on her new role of Chief Executive Officer at Hockey NSW.
